Robust SSH Server: Dropbear for Linux
Dropbear presents lightweight and efficient SSH server that functions well with resource-constrained systems. Originally designed for embedded devices, it commonly operates as a reliable choice for regular servers where minimizing resource consumption plays a crucial role in.
Featuring its key features are its small footprint, low memory usage, and remarkable security. Moreover, Dropbear offers compatibility for a broad range of authentication protocols, including Public Key Cryptography.
Installing Dropbear on Linux is a easy process. The package is in most major Linux distributions' archives, making it readily obtainable. Once installed, configuring Dropbear to meet your individual security requirements is manageable.
Setting Up a Lightweight SSH Server with Dropbear
Dropbear is a lightweight and efficient SSH server. It utilizes minimal resources, making it perfect for embedded systems or constrained environments where performance is crucial.
Deploying Dropbear involves setting up its source code and then configuring its settings to match your specifications. A common method is to configure Dropbear with a strong password or digital key authentication for enhanced security.
Upon successful installation, you can connect to your server using an SSH client such as Putty. This allows you to manage the system remotely, execute commands, and transfer files securely.
Dropbear also offers enhanced features like tunneling and port forwarding, providing greater flexibility for remote access scenarios.
